Why Floral Flower Tattoos Resonate
Floral tattoos stand out as timeless symbols across cultures and eras. Their vibrant colors, intricate patterns, and natural grace capture more than just a pretty image—they carry deep meaning:
- Peace: Flowers like lotuses, peonies, and cherry blossoms symbolize calm, enlightenment, and serenity.
- Love: Roses, lavender, and blooming vines represent affection, passion, and lasting connection.
- Blooms: The very image of blossoming flowers represents growth, transformation, and flourishing potential.
Together, floral tattoos heartfully celebrate life’s delicacies and enduring beauty.

Top Peaceful Flower Tattoos to Inspire
1. Lavender Fields
Soft purples and calming grays mimic serene landscapes, perfect for expressing calm and mindfulness. Lavender signifies peace, healing, and gentle strength.
2. Cherry Blossom Tattoos
These delicate pink blooms symbolize the transient nature of life and renewal. Ideal for those drawn to nature’s fleeting beauty and philosophical depth.
3. Sacred Lotus
Rooted in Eastern traditions, the lotus flower blooms effortlessly from murky waters—perfect for themes of spiritual awakening, purity, and inner peace.

4. Peony Cascades
With their lush, layered petals, peonies embody prosperity, romance, and flourishing joy—ideal for expressing deep love and grace.
5. Wildflower Sprigs
A free-spirited design with a mix of colorful blooms representing resilience and the beauty of uncaroused life.
Lavish Love-Infused Floral Designs
Flower tattoos are equally expressive in romance:
- Roses: The classic choice—red for passion, white for purity, pink for gratitude.
- Wisteria: Cascading blue-violet blooms evoke enduring devotion and romantic enchantment.
- Vine Heart Mix: Twining vines and blossoms entwined capture connection and lasting love.
- Personalized Bloom Sprigs: Incorporating flowers meaningful to a couple—like elderflowers for second chances or sunflowers for loyalty.
Finding Your Perfect Bloomatic Statement
Choosing a floral flower tattoo starts with personal meaning. Ask yourself:
- What flower or bloom speaks to your heart?
- Do you value peace, passion, or transformation?
- Visualize how colors and styles (realistic, watercolor, minimal) align with your style.
Consider consulting a skilled tattoo artist who specializes in botanical designs—many blend traditional techniques with modern flair, ensuring your tattoo blooms beautifully for years.
